How To Fix RSTRAN041 - Unable to delete transformation


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: RSTRAN - Messages for Transformation

  • Message number: 041

  • Message text: Unable to delete transformation

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message RSTRAN041 - Unable to delete transformation ?

    The SAP error message RSTRAN041 ("Unable to delete transformation") typically occurs in the context of SAP BW (Business Warehouse) when you attempt to delete a transformation that is either in use or has dependencies that prevent its deletion. Here are some common causes, solutions, and related information for this error:

    Causes:

    1. Active Usage: The transformation is currently being used by one or more data flows, such as InfoPackages, DTPs (Data Transfer Processes), or other transformations.
    2. Dependencies: There may be dependent objects, such as DTPs or InfoProviders, that rely on the transformation you are trying to delete.
    3. Authorization Issues: The user attempting to delete the transformation may not have the necessary authorizations to perform this action.
    4. Transport Requests: The transformation might be part of a transport request that is still in process or has not been released.

    Solutions:

    1. Check Dependencies:

      • Use transaction RSO2 (for transformations) to check if the transformation is being used by any DTPs or other objects. If it is, you will need to delete or deactivate those dependencies first.
      • You can also check the DTPs associated with the transformation in transaction RSO1.
    2. Deactivate the Transformation:

      • If the transformation is active, try deactivating it first. You can do this in the transformation maintenance screen.
    3. Remove Related Objects:

      • If there are DTPs or other objects that depend on the transformation, consider removing or modifying those objects before attempting to delete the transformation.
    4. Check Authorizations:

      • Ensure that you have the necessary authorizations to delete transformations. You may need to consult with your SAP security team if you suspect authorization issues.
    5. Transport Request:

      • If the transformation is part of a transport request, check the status of the transport. You may need to release the transport or remove the transformation from the transport request.
    6. Use Transaction SE11:

      • In some cases, you can use transaction SE11 to check the underlying database table for the transformation and see if there are any inconsistencies.
